Chat with a School Board Member ....
The School board wants to hear from you!
The Board of Directors has set a variety of dates, times and locations to meet with their constituents throughout the school year. Board members look forward to listening and learning about the communities' opinions, suggestions, and concerns. There is no agenda for these events; they are completely informal and anyone can attend.
Listed below are remaining fall dates - additional dates will be set later in the school year. All events start at 6 p.m. and will be held in the school library:
